Provides that state cosmetology curriculums and examinations reflect instruction concerning cultural and ethnic awareness in regard to hair type. |

Go to top STATE OF NEW YORK ________________________________________________________________________ 2042 2015-2016 Regular Sessions IN ASSEMBLY January 15, 2015 ___________ Introduced by M. of A. PRETLOW -- read once and referred to the Commit- tee on Economic Development AN ACT to amend the general business law, in relation to providing that state cosmetology curriculums and examinations reflect instruction concerning cultural and ethnic awareness in regard to hair types The People of the State of New York, represented in Senate and Assem- bly, do enact as follows: 1 Section 1. Subdivisions 1 and 3 of section 403 of the general busi- 2 ness law, subdivision 1 as amended by chapter 341 of the laws of 1998 3 and subdivision 3 as added by chapter 509 of the laws of 1992, are 4 amended to read as follows: 5 1. There shall be established within the department an advisory 6 committee which shall consist of [nine] ten members broadly represen- 7 tative of the appearance enhancement industry[,]; including one person 8 engaged in the practice of either nail specialty or waxing[,]; two 9 persons engaged in natural hair styling[,]; one of whom shall be know- 10 ledgeable in the practice of styling techniques which place tension on 11 the hair roots[,]; one person engaged in esthetics[,]; two persons 12 engaged in cosmetology[,]; two persons engaged in training of persons 13 for such practices[, and]; one person licensed as a dermatologist; and 14 one person who shall ensure strict adherence to quality services for all 15 clients of all hair types, including, but not limited to, curl pattern, 16 hair strand thickness, and volume of hair. The secretary shall appoint 17 such persons to serve on the advisory committee, provided, that two 18 shall be appointed by the secretary on the recommendation of the tempo- 19 rary president of the senate and two shall be appointed by the secretary 20 on the recommendation of the speaker of the assembly. Each member of the 21 committee shall be appointed for terms of two years. Any member may be 22 reappointed for additional terms. The secretary shall designate from 23 among the members of the committee a chairperson who shall serve at the 24 pleasure of the secretary. EXPLANATION--Matter in italics (underscored) is new; matter in brackets [] is old law to be omitted. LBD05376-01-5A. 2042 2 1 3. The advisory committee shall advise the secretary on all matters 2 relating to this article, and on such other matters as the secretary 3 shall request. In advising the secretary on matters concerning profes- 4 sional education or curriculum, inclusive of the maintenance of cultural 5 and ethnic awareness within the prescribed curriculum in regard to hair 6 types, including, but not limited to, curl pattern, hair strand thick- 7 ness, and volume of hair, the advisory committee shall, to the extent 8 practicable, consult with the state education department. 9 § 2. Subdivision 1 of section 407 of the general business law, as 10 amended by chapter 255 of the laws of 1999, is amended to read as 11 follows: 12 1. The examinations for the license to practice natural hair styling, 13 esthetics, nail specialty and cosmetology shall be practical and writ- 14 ten. The examinations for the license to practice waxing shall be limit- 15 ed to a written examination only. The secretary shall determine reason- 16 able standards of performance for each license and shall evaluate the 17 prospective applicants and applicants on the basis of such standards. 18 The objectives of the examinations shall be to insure that prospective 19 applicants and applicants have sufficient basic skills to safeguard the 20 health and safety of the public and to insure that prospective appli- 21 cants and applicants have attained adequate levels of skill to compe- 22 tently engage clients of all hair types, including, but not limited to, 23 curl pattern, hair strand thickness, and volume of hair in the activ- 24 ities authorized by the license. 25 § 3. This act shall take effect immediately.
